全球分销商数据接入接口的全面下沉,正倒逼在线旅游平台对票务信息同步机制进行一场链路级重构。当数据对接点从集中式网关迁移至更贴近赛事资源端的边缘节点,瞬时高并发场景下亚秒级延迟的容忍度被压减至零。这套体系不再依赖中心化平台的定时轮询,而是通过直连API接口构建起多径并发的数据贯通网络。系统冗余响应不再是灾备兜底,而升格为核心热切换组件。每一张球票的状态变更,从确认时刻起便循着最短路径涌向全球数百个分销终端,传统批次处理逻辑在此刻被彻底剥离。在这种架构下,OTA系统面临的挑战不再是带宽扩容,而是如何在海量并发写入中维持数据一致性与状态同步的精确锚定,这一结构性转变迫使整个票务履约链路重新梳理自身的防抖动与削峰机制。
在接口下沉之前,全球票务分销长期依赖一套以中心化聚合网关为核心的数据同步模型。赛事票务系统将库存、价格、坐席状态等元数据批量推送至一个或数个区域性的数据聚合点,再由下游分销商以固定的时间间隔发起轮询请求。这种架构的设计初衷是为了降低源头系统的连接负载,通过中间层缓存来吸收读取压力。面对非赛事时段相对平缓的票务流动,数十秒甚至分钟级的更新延迟并未造成实质性业务受损。分销商终端展示的库存数据与实际成交之间存在一个被默许的滞后窗口,其履约安全由人工预留的超额缓冲库存来兜底。
这套机制的物理限制在票务流动性骤然爬升时暴露无遗。小组赛最后一轮出线生死战或淘汰赛对阵揭晓的瞬间,全球用户在同一秒内涌向不同分销终端,轮询周期的任何一次重合都可能导致同一坐席被多个渠道同时锁定。为规避超售风险,分销商通常会在网关返回的可用库存基础上主动扣减一个固定比例,这一保守策略直接压低了票务资源的流通效率,大量席位在分销链路上被虚假占用。更深层的矛盾在于,中心化网关对全量数据的无差别转发消耗了大量冗余带宽,一旦某条洲际链路出现抖动,重试风暴会迅速向源头系统回溯,整个分销树形结构均缺乏独立的容错隔离机制。
当时分销接口的治理完全依托于全球分销商接入协议中约定的人工熔断条款。运维团队守在监控大屏前,依据经验判断流量尖峰是否属于攻击特征,手动切换冗余链路。这种以分钟计的人因响应在双十一级别的电商场景中已然吃力,落在时效敏感度极高的体育票务领域,每一次犹豫都转化为现金流与品牌信用的直接折损。系统冗余在此阶段仅作为冷备存在,其启动流程涉及DNS切换、会话重建与数据对齐,从决策到完成接管往往跨越了票务最关键的销售窗口。
触发架构蜕变的直接压力源自上一届洲际顶级赛事期间暴露出的数据同步塌方事故。半决赛票务启动的八十六秒内,两个大洲的分销网关先后因内存溢出触发保护性重启,超过四万条有效票务状态变更积压在消息开云队列中,导致分销终端持续展示已核销的幽灵库存。事故复盘指向一个根本矛盾:中心化网关的横向扩容速度始终追不上票务并发请求的瞬时爬坡斜率。硬件扩容的分钟级交付在面对秒级流量脉冲时等同于无效部署,唯有将数据对接点前移至系统源头,并剥离中间节点的缓冲职能,才能将同步延迟从秒级压入毫秒级区间。
直连API接口技术的成熟恰好为此提供了可落地的技术底座。基于gRPC协议构建的双向流式传输通道,允许票务源头系统主动向已认证的分销端点推送状态变更,而非被动等待轮询指令。每条连接均以长链路保持心跳,一旦坐席状态发生原子性变更,事件即被序列化为轻量级二进制帧,经预置的路由表分发给持有该坐席销售权限的所有在线端点。这套推送模型天然具备多径并发能力,单条链路的断开仅影响该路径,不再通过中心节点向全部分销商传导故障。接口下沉的另一层含义在于鉴权逻辑的分布式部署,每个边缘节点均内嵌完整的票据核验规则引擎,无需回源即可完成90%以上的写入合法性校验。
全球分销商接入协议的条款也随之重新拟订,从过去对响应超时的罚则约束,转向对接口吞吐率、推送成功率与断连恢复时长的硬性指标绑定。协议中首次引入“系统冗余响应”作为强制技术准入项,要求分销商在接入前完成热备链路的自动化切换演练。这意味着冗余链路不再被视作成本中心或应急装饰,而是成为接入授权的基础前提。分销商若无法在五十毫秒内完成主备通道的无感切换,其数据获取优先级将被自动降级。这一协议层面的刚性约束,倒逼所有下游技术团队将冗余路由从被动冷备重构为常驻热机,彻底改变了此前系统架构中容灾模块的附属地位。
OTA系统的应对策略围绕“削峰填谷”与“状态确权”两条主线展开,整体架构被重新梳理为三层隔离结构。最前端是部署在边缘节点的请求归并层,负责将同一票务分区内毫秒级内涌来的数万次查询请求,压缩为单次针对源端系统的状态确认调用。这一层的核心组件是一张基于坐席唯一标识的内存哈希表,任何已有准确状态的查询直接由边缘节点短路返回,不穿透到核心票务库。当票务状态发生变更时,源头系统以广播方式向所有持权边缘节点推送失效指令,迫使节点在下一次查询时主动拉取最新状态,从而规避了缓存陈旧导致的数据冲突。
中间层则引入了异步化的写入队列调度机制。所有来自分销终端的下单请求不再同步竞争源端数据库的行级锁,而是被序列化为一组带有全局唯一流水号的事务消息,进入按坐席分区排列的顺序队列。每个分区由单一工作线程承担串行消费,确保同一坐席在同一时刻仅有一条写入操作被提交执行。这种将并发写入强制串行化的设计,从底层数据块上剥离了多线程锁竞争的复杂度,系统无需再维护复杂的分布式锁超时与重入逻辑。当某条写入事务在处理过程中返回异常,队列调度器自动将其转入重试通道,其余分区队列不受任何影响,整个写入管线的吞吐稳定性由此得到结构性的加固。
状态同步的最终确权环节被下沉至一套分布式的票务状态账本之中。每一张票据从创建、锁定到核销的完整生命周期变更,均以追加日志的形式记录在多个地理分布的副本节点上。OTA系统在收到推送的最终态后,需向至少两个不同副本节点发送确认回执,该状态才被标记为已同步。若在确认周期内发生节点故障,系统冗余响应机制将自动启用另一条预设链路重放未确认的状态变更序列。这套多副本确认模型保证了即使在洲际链路大面积抖动的最坏工况下,任何已成交的票务状态最终都能准确锚定到所有销售终端,不会出现因同步断档而流入市场的无效库存。
接口下沉对票务履约链路的实际影响首先体现在入场核验环节的即时性上。此前球迷持电子票到达球场闸机时,分销系统与现场核验终端之间的数据通路往往需要经由多个转接节点,核验响应时间波动在八百毫秒至两秒之间。直连链路贯通后,分销平台将闸机校验请求直接路由至票务源头系统部署在场馆的边缘算力集群,全程跳过了跨境骨干网的多次跃点转发。核验指令在SRT协议的低延迟约束下完成双向握手,球迷手机屏幕上的二维码被扫描的瞬间,票务状态即在源头完成不可逆的核销标记,残留在任何中间节点上的旧状态同时被强制失效广播所覆盖。
分销商端的库存视图也完成了实时化改造,原有分批次的定时同步被事件驱动的增量更新所取代。当某位用户在芝加哥的OTA平台上释放了一张决赛门票,这一释放事件在三十毫秒内即被推送到东京、伦敦、圣保罗所有持有该赛事授权的分销界面。票务流动性由此获得本质释放,不再有任何坐席因同步延迟而被错误锁定在长尾渠道中。值得注意的是,这种跨地域的零冗余分发并非通过无限度堆叠带宽实现,而是依托于推送协议内置的差异压缩算法。每次推送仅传输发生变更的字段偏移量而非完整数据行,将单次事件的数据净荷压减至不足一百字节,使得系统即使在峰值时段也能维持推送链路的轻量化运行。
运维排障体系也从人工盯屏转入了自动化故障闭环。当某条直连链路连续三次心跳超时,路由控制器自动将该链路上的全量流量切换到地理位置上最邻近的一条备用通道,整个过程不触发任何人工审批节点。被隔离的故障链路随即进入自诊断循环,协议层逐级检测从物理层到应用层的所有状态点,诊断结果直接注入运维知识库并关联到过往相似故障案例。若自愈程序判定故障属间歇性抖动,链路在连续三十秒正常通讯后自动恢复在线,此前切换期间积压的推送消息通过断点续传机制无损补齐。这套故障自愈闭环让系统冗余响应真正下沉为API接口的原生能力,而非架设在外部的高高在上的安全气囊。
票务分销链路已完成从定时轮询向事件推送的全量迁移,全球主要OTA平台均已在生产环境中跑通直连接口的全链路压测。这套架构正以毫秒级同步精度支撑着当前周期内所有已开售场次的实时票务流转,分布式账本的追平延迟稳定控制在个位数毫秒区间。
系统冗余响应不再是墙上的应急预案,而是嵌入每一行数据推送代码中的热执行路径。边缘节点与源端之间的状态同步当前正以每秒钟数万次推送的强度持续运转,这套去中心化分销网络在刚结束的淘汰赛售票窗口中扛住了单秒十六万次并发写入的洪峰冲击,全部成交票务的状态同步无一例进入人工干预队列。
